How does the Dancing with the Wind plant grow leaves? Does it grow fast?

1. How to grow leaves

1. Exposure to light: If you want the Dancing Plant to grow leaves, it needs to be exposed to more sunlight and receive sufficient sunlight. However, proper shade is needed in the summer, and more ventilation is needed to prevent the branches and leaves from rotting and shrivelling.

2. Watering: Not only should you ensure that the plant has sufficient water, you should also spray it with water as much as possible so that its leaves can absorb enough water. Be sure to open the windows after spraying water, otherwise leaves are likely to fall off.

3. Pruning: If you find leaves that are black rot, yellow, or growing poorly on the plant, you need to prune them in time. Proper pruning can allow other branches and leaves to grow more luxuriantly.

4. Fertilization: There must be sufficient nutrients during maintenance. Fertilizer should be applied once every 20 days or so during the growing period. Only with sufficient nutrients can the leaves grow better. However, fertilization should be suspended during the plant's dormant period.

2. Is it growing fast?

The growth rate of Dancing Plant is not very fast, but as long as it is well maintained, it will change greatly every year. The growth of the plant is closely related to the maintenance method, so try to provide a suitable growth environment.
